Gamaliel was an instructor of Jewish Law and Paul's teacher. Gamaliel means God is my recompense. He instructed the Jewish leaders not to be too harsh with the new Christians because if Jesus were indeed a false prophet, his teachings would soon fade away. On the other hand, if Jesus was genuine, they could not stop it anyway.
